using System;
using System.ComponentModel;
using ProtoBuf.Meta;
namespace ProtoBuf
{
    /// 
    /// Indicates the known-types to support for an individual
    /// message. This serializes each level in the hierarchy as
    /// a nested message to retain wire-compatibility with
    /// other protocol-buffer implementations.
    /// 
    [AttributeUsage(AttributeTargets.Class | AttributeTargets.Interface, AllowMultiple = true, Inherited = false)]
    public sealed class ProtoIncludeAttribute : Attribute
    {
        ///
        /// Creates a new instance of the ProtoIncludeAttribute.
        /// 
        /// The unique index (within the type) that will identify this data.
        /// The additional type to serialize/deserialize.
        public ProtoIncludeAttribute(int tag, Type knownType)
            : this(tag, knownType == null ? "" : knownType.AssemblyQualifiedName) { }
        /// 
        /// Creates a new instance of the ProtoIncludeAttribute.
        /// 
        /// The unique index (within the type) that will identify this data.
        /// The additional type to serialize/deserialize.
        public ProtoIncludeAttribute(int tag, string knownTypeName)
        {
            if (tag <= 0) throw new ArgumentOutOfRangeException(nameof(tag), "Tags must be positive integers");
            if (string.IsNullOrEmpty(knownTypeName)) throw new ArgumentNullException(nameof(knownTypeName), "Known type cannot be blank");
            Tag = tag;
            KnownTypeName = knownTypeName;
        }
        /// 
        /// Gets the unique index (within the type) that will identify this data.
        /// 
        public int Tag { get; }
        /// 
        /// Gets the additional type to serialize/deserialize.
        /// 
        public string KnownTypeName { get; }
        /// 
        /// Gets the additional type to serialize/deserialize.
        /// 
        public Type KnownType => TypeModel.ResolveKnownType(KnownTypeName, null, null);
        /// 
        /// Specifies whether the inherited sype's sub-message should be
        /// written with a length-prefix (default), or with group markers.
        /// 
        [DefaultValue(DataFormat.Default)]
        public DataFormat DataFormat { get; set; } = DataFormat.Default;
    }
}
